On Mon, 14 Jul 2003, svante t. stipulated:
> gcc -g -DHAVE_CONFIG_H -DGETTIMEOFDAY_TWO_ARGS -DSIMULATOR :0.0 -DBIG_ENDIAN -I. -I../../firmware/drivers -I../../firmware/export
> -I../../apps -I../../apps/player -I../common -I. -W -Wall -c

What's that :0.0 doing in there? It looks like you've got a $DISPLAY *in
the command line*... perhaps the makefile has a variable called DISPLAY
which isn't getting set?
